When NJ's stupid FID law was passed back in 68 I guess my dad did his civic duty and applied and received his card.  Never used it until I wanted a competition pellet gun while in High School.  Yes back then my HS had a rifle team.  Anyway, he was detained by the Paramus PD for attempted purchase of a firearm with a forged card.  Seems the originals were green in color and the issuing department never put his SBI number on the card.  Clerk at Ramsey Outdoor freaked and called the POPO.  They called the issuing PD and released him.   He swore he would never use it again and never did.
